Transaction 7cf96bfb203d5510f56b8b5c36f0a5ab4fe3a20779e006ccd23769de525ac5be
1 Input
1 Output
-
7cf96bfb203d5510f56b8b5c36f0a5ab4fe3a20779e006ccd23769de525ac5be:0
- value
- 41097929
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f612267e0cf1a6302a78b0a0c5b517d135affaf OP_EQUAL
- address
- MJ45bjrMMTHxV1oRTYGRenQGEmxey6aMQc